Unlike a fixed annuity that gives a surefire rate of interest, a fixed indexed annuity is tied to a wide market index. Your returns are based upon the performance of this index, based on a cap and a flooring.
This can supply an appealing balance for those seeking modest development without the greater danger account of a variable annuity. If you believe a repaired annuity might be the right option for you, right here are some things to consider. Annuities can provide routine, foreseeable income for an established number of years or the rest of your life. Nevertheless, usually talking, the longer you desire repayments to last, the lower the amount of each repayment.
Survivor benefit: It is very important to consider what will certainly occur to the cash in your repaired annuity if you die while there's still a balance in your account. A survivor benefit attribute allows you to mark a beneficiary that will obtain a specified amount upon your death, either as a swelling sum or in the form of continued payments.
Certified annuities are moneyed with pre-tax bucks, generally with retirement plans like a 401(k) or individual retirement account. Costs payments aren't taken into consideration taxed revenue for the year they are paid, however when you take income in the distribution stage, the whole amount is normally based on tax obligations. Nonqualified annuities are funded with after-tax dollars, so taxes have currently been paid on the payments.

A set annuity is one of the most uncomplicated type, providing a trusted and predictable revenue stream. The insurer assures a fixed passion rate on your premium, which produces a constant revenue stream over the rest of your life or a details period. Like deposit slips, these annuities are commonly the best service for even more risk-averse investors and are among the best investment choices for retired life portfolios.
Typical dealt with annuities might lack protection from rising cost of living. Set annuities have a stated passion price you gain no matter of the market's performance, which may imply missing out on out on prospective gains.

Both Individual retirement accounts and postponed annuities are tax-advantaged means to intend for retired life. They work in extremely various ways. As discussed over, an IRA is a financial savings account that offers tax benefits. It resembles a basket in which you can place different sorts of investments. Annuities, on the various other hand, are insurance coverage products that convert some cost savings right into guaranteed repayments.
A specific retired life account (IRA) is a kind of retired life cost savings automobile that enables investments you make to grow in a tax-advantaged means. They are a fantastic method to conserve lengthy term for retired life.

Frequently, these investments are supplies, bonds, mutual funds, or also annuities. Each year, you can invest a particular quantity within your IRA account ($6,500 in 2023 and subject to alter in the future), and that financial investment will grow tax obligation totally free.
When you take out funds in retirement, though, it's strained as average income. With a Roth IRA, the cash you place in has actually already been tired, however it expands free of tax for many years. Those earnings can after that be withdrawn free of tax if you are 59 or older and it has gone to least 5 years since you initially contributed to the Roth IRA.

Individual retirement accounts are retirement savings accounts. Annuities are insurance policy products. You can sometimes place annuities in an Individual retirement account however, or make use of tax-qualified Individual retirement account funds to acquire an annuity.
Annuities have been around for a long period of time, however they have actually become extra typical lately as individuals are living longer, fewer people are covered by standard pension, and preparing for retired life has come to be more vital. They can frequently be combined with various other insurance products like life insurance coverage to develop complete protection for you and your family members.
